Amazon Games have in the new roadmap announced many exciting innovations and content for the MMO Lost Ark that you can look forward to in the first months of the coming year 2023. In particular, fans of The Witcher should sit up and take notice, because a cross-over event will start shortly.
Lost Ark lets you quest with Geralt and Ciri from The Witcher
It starts in January: Lost Ark players in the west can now also get the big Witcher x Lost Ark cross-over event that started in Korea a month ago.
A completely new island awaits you here in a playful way, on which you can complete quests for well-known characters such as Geralt, Ciri, Delphinium or Yennefer during the event period. You will also be able to buy many Witcher cosmetics in the shop.

More highlights of the Lost Ark roadmap for 2023
- Rowen-Continent: On the new continent of Rowen, two factions are fighting for the land, you can get involved from item level 1445 and experience many new quests again. The continent will be released in February.
- 96-player PvP: In the Tulubik battlefield there are not only an incredible number of enemies to fight, but also bases that want to be conquered. The new PvP mode will be available from March and requires an item level of 1490.
- new class: With the artist (English: Artist) a new class comes into play, which is support and DPS at the same time and swings an oversized brush. It will be released in April 2023.
